With my KLX340, I can literally lug it down to it's final weezes, then goose the throttle and she picks right back up. No flame-outs or hiccups. I've kinda gotten used to that, and I didn't want a bike that I have rev and clutch all the time. The TE 310 is considerably lighter than my KLX, plus they were on sale, so that's what led me to look at one.

After even the Husky dealers told me that the TE 310 needs to be revved and ridden hard to make it happy, I moved on to look at other bikes. I was asking how you liked your Husky to see if I made the right call. This is what I ended up buying...
